Understanding Research Peptide Purity and Analysis

Assessing the peptide's purity is absolutely essential for accurate research findings. Measuring the peptide’s cleanness often involves several analytical methods , such as High-Performance Liquid HPLC (HPLC) coupled with Mass Spectrometry (MS) and Amino Acid Analysis . These assessments offer information regarding such presence of byproducts and help researchers to ensure such identity and genuineness of the synthesized molecule.

Managing Research Chains Safety Guidelines

Careful handling of lab chains necessitates rigorous safety precautions due to their potential active activity. Regularly don appropriate personal equipment , such as gloves , visual defense , and laboratory gowns . Avoid cutaneous exposure and breathing in by performing procedures within a fume hood . Chain solutions should be treated as possibly hazardous substances , requiring specific disposal procedures . Consult the chemical secure data form (MSDS/SDS) for specific data regarding the individual fragment being utilized .
